I've found at least one port that does not compile correctly with the base system gcc(1) if the code is compiled with optimizations on (at least -O or higher) , the port is sysutils/smartmontools. If compiled with optimizations on, smartctl will segfault as soon as you query a device. Turning off optimizations with -O0 fixes the problem, also compiling the port with newer lang/gcc46 with default optimizations results in working binary.
